After completing your purchase, you’re just a few steps away from using Aperty. Follow the instructions below to download, install, and set up the software on your device. This guide will help you navigate the installation process smoothly, whether you’re using Windows or Mac.

  1. Download the Software: After the purchase, you’ll receive email with the link to download the installer. Moreover, you can also download the app in your Skylum account, from the .

  2. Run the Installer:

    • For Windows: Double-click the installer file (.exe) and follow the on-screen prompts to install the software.

    • For Mac: Open the installer file (.dmg), drag the Aperty icon into the Applications folder, and complete the installation.

  3. Follow Setup Instructions: Double-click the Aperty installer. You’ll see an installation screen:

  • Click the ‘Accept’ button to proceed with the installation.

  • If you use Adobe Photoshop or Adobe Lightroom Classic and wish to use Aperty as a plugin, you’ll have the option to install the plugin on the next screen:

This step is not obligatory: if you don’t use these applications, simply click ‘Install’ to continue without installing the plugin.

  • Once the installation is complete, click the ‘Launch’ button to open Aperty.

Launching the Software

  • From Desktop: After installation, simply double-click the Aperty icon on your desktop (or in the Applications folder on Mac).

  • From the Start Menu (Windows): You can also launch Aperty by clicking on the Start Menu, searching for "Aperty," and selecting the application from the list.
